Ghalib Al-Mashoor is having more than 27 years of work experience in various Financial & Banking Investment fields, who has extensively travelled and attended more than 200 “Economic & Investment seminars” both International and local. There are more than 500 Fund Managers, and about 2000 International contacts are in his diary since inception of his career. Al-Mashoor joined United Arab Shipping Company (GCC Govt. owned, multi Billion capital Shipping Company) in 2001 as an “Senior Financial Analyst” and promoted to become an “Investment Manager” . He is managing UASC’s multi-million Dollar Contingency Reserve Portfolio (diversified into various asset classes). Al-Mashoor’s previous employer was “Inter-Arab Investment Guarantee Corporation” (owned by 22 Arab nations – An Export Guarantee Institution) head quartered in Kuwait. He was assigned to take care of all their investments in capital markets. During the invasion of Kuwait in 1990, he was assigned to travel to IAIGC offices in Jordan, Egypt, Saudi Arabia for taking full responsibility of the investments, in addition to Kuwait. He worked about 13 years (1988-2000) for IAIGC as the “Chief Dealer for Investments” . After and before securing Bachelor’s degree in 1985, He was offered employments in couple of Institutions in the capacity of “Financial Operations officer, Trader of U. S. Securities & FX” etc.. at BIC, Kuwait Real Estate Investment Consortium & IIC and later as the “Head of Operations “with Anderson Lloyd International (A British based financial advisory firm)“. Ghalib enjoys economic news writing and community charitable works holds a Ph.D (Doctor of Business Administration) since 2008, along with two Master degrees (Bus. Adm.) in the years 2002 & 2007.
